This complex is horrible. The staff is not only unprofessional but most are highly incompetent. I have requested that maintenance issues be handled and some were but others are totally ignored, of course the ones ignored would most likely be costly.
Several buildings have major foundation problems (walls cracking apartment shifting)
And the neighborhood is like the projects, prostitution, drug dealing and many burglaries. I think the city is trying to clean up the neighborhood and granted I have seen progress but I will move as soon as I am able. Only a couple of people I have spoken to are happy with this staff and complex. The only flowers in the landscaping that brighten up the place are of course smack dab in front of the office so they can enjoy them. And that is another thing the landscaping company is a little scary looking. I also had an incident with maintenance where they needed to send an outside company in to handle the problem and when they came I was sleeping and did not hear the door, well they had given this man (scary looking again) a key and there was not a staff member with him. Mind you I am a female who lives alone. I could probably sue them over that one. The insulation is horrible I am heating or cooling the outside as well as the inside (this issue was brought to their attention with no results)
